서울의 Penicillinase Producing Neisseria gonorrhoeae 발생빈도(1998)

In recent years, gonorrhea has been pandemic and remains one of the most common STDs in the world, especially in developing countries. For the detection of a more effective therapeutic regimen and assessing the prevalence of Penicillinase Producing Neisseria gonorrhoeae(PPNG), we have been trying to study the patients who have visited the Venereal Disease Clinic of Choong-Ku Public Health Center in Seoul since 1980 by menas of the chromogenic cephalosporin method. In 1998, 93 strians of N. genorrhoeae were isolated, among which 60(64.5%) were PPNG. The prevalence of PPNG in Seoul, which had been decreased to 39% in 1996 after a peak of 74.3% in 1993, is increased to 64.5% in 1998.

A Interior material, a main cause of fire-growth and generating toxic gas it burns, should be dealt with great care in life safety design. Nonetheless, it has been used recklessly with undue attention to its contribution to fire in particular in entertainment occupancy and causes many victims in fire, Therefore, this study attempts to examine the current use of interior material in Korea and find out what to be improved and enhanced in terms of related regulations. Based on the comparison and analysis of the Korea regulation with those of advanced nation, suggestions are made for an effective and efficient improvement and complement to the current system. What can be suggested from this study are as follows. · The use of interior material should be controlled under the unified regulation of fire-safety codes. · Code should be set up so that the current construction enforcement should be applied in retroactive to those entertainment buildings that obtained a license prior to the implementation of the system certifying that the building is fire-resistant and fire-protection. ·The legislation should be made to control the fire-protection facilities of small-sized, underground entertainments. · It should be obliged to present the blueprint displaying the use of interior material at the time of changing occupancy. Or, it should be compelled to report changes that go way without permit to the administrative office. · A compulsory provision should be set up to have a fire-resistant performance to movable furniture. · The classification index designating the fire hazard of interior material by flame spread rate and smoke toxicity and its test method should be established.

To investigate how the robot traces the predetermined path, Cartesian trajectory, 4-3-4 trajectory, 3-5-3 trajectory, cycloid trajectory planning were applied to the Rhino XR-Ⅲ robot system. The trajectories drawn directly by robot, travelling times and jointangle variations were examined for those trajectory plannings. In the case of single path, all trajectories reached about 97% to destination position along the predetermined path. The travelling time of 4-3-4 trajectory was shorter than any other trajectories. On account of round-off error, structual allowances, influence of dynamics and friction force, differences between real trajectories and theoretical trajectories occurred.

Background: To reduce the signs of aging, many different laser and other light-based systems have been developed and evaluated for their ability. Objectives: This study was designed to evaluate the effects of the novel grid fractional radiofrequency (GFR) treatment on skin structure and collagen production in vivo. Methods: The GFR device was used to deliver radiofrequency (RF) energy to skin. To compare the effects of different energy level, we used two different parameters, 84W and 200W for 2 seconds. The wound healing response was evaluated histologically and by RT-PCR up to 10 weeks post-RF treatment. Changes of diameter of collagen fiber were assessed by electron microscopy. Results: Dermal thickness, cellularity, and elastin content increased. RT-PCR studies revealed an immediate increase in IL-1b, TNF-a, and MMP-13 while MMP-1, HSP70.2, HSP47, and TGF-b levels increased by 2 days. We also observed a marked induction of tropoelastin, fibrillin, as well as collagen type 1 and 3 by 28 days post-treatment. Conclusion: Our study revealed a vigorous wound healing response is initiated post-treatment with progressive increase in inflammatory cell infiltration from day 2 through 10 weeks. Furthermore, we successfully demonstrated for the evidence of profound neocollagenesis and neoelastogenesis following RF treatment of human skin. The combination of neoelastogenesis and neocollagenesis induced by treatment with the GFR system may provide a reliable treatment option for skin laxity and rhytids.
P081 : A clinical study of skin diseases on the anogenital areas

Background: Skin diseases on the anogenital areas cause sexual and functional problems, and these problems are important to most patients, so awareness of these disease entities is very important. Objectives: This study was performed to investigate the epidemiological aspects of skin diseases on anogenital areas that were confirmed by biopsies, and we wanted to highlight the clinical features of dermatoses of the anogenital areas. Methods: We retrospectively reviewed the data of 132 patients with anogenital lesions and these lesions were confirmed by biopsy at Kangbuk Samsung Hospital between January 2008 and June 2013. Results: The ratio of males to females was 104:28. The most frequent anogenital skin diseases of men were condyloma acuminatum(26%), epidermal cyst(9%), calcinosis cutis(7%), extramammary paget`s disease(7%), and the most frequent anogenital skin diseases of women were condyloma acuminatum(25%), Behcet`s disease(18%), epidermal cyst(11%). Of the 132 cases, 81 had papules or nodules, 32 had patches or plaques, and 19 had vesicles, erosions or ulcers. Conclusion: We retrospectively studied 132 cases of anogenital skin diseases. This study suggests that various conditions, including sexually transmitted infections, neoplasms, ulcerative disorders, and inflammatory dermatoses, can affect the anogenital areas and show different characteristics according to the diagnosis. These diseasespecific characteristics may be helpful to diagnosis before histopathological confirmations.
Identification of differentially-expressed genes by DNA methylation in cervical cancer

<P>To identify novel cervical cancer-related genes that are regulated by DNA methylation, integrated analyses of genome-wide DNA methylation and RNA expression profiles were performed using the normal and tumor regions of tissues from four patients; two with cervical cancer and two with pre-invasive cancer. The present study identified 19 novel cervical cancer-related genes showing differential RNA expression by DNA methylation. A number of the identified genes were novel cervical cancer-related genes and their differential expression was confirmed in a publicly available database. Among the candidate genes, the epigenetic regulation and expression of three genes, <I>CAMK2N1</I>, <I>ALDH1A3</I> and <I>PPP1R3C</I>, was validated in HeLa cells treated with a demethylating reagent using methylation-specific polymerase chain reaction (PCR) and quantitative PCR, respectively. From these results, the expression of the <I>CAMK2N1</I>, <I>ALDH1A3</I> and <I>PPP1R3C</I> genes are were shown to be suppressed in cervical cancers by DNA methylation. These genes may be involved in the progression or initiation of cervical cancer.</P>
